区块链技术应用的全面解析:从基础知识到实践

              区块链是一种创新技术,自2008年比特币的诞生以来,迅速发展并广泛应用于多个领域。其去中心化、不可篡改和透明的特性,使得区块链在金融服务、供应链管理、医疗、版权保护等领域表现出极大的潜力。然而,许多人对区块链的应用实际上了解不深,特别是如何学习这一技术以便更好地融入这个迅速发展的行业。 本篇文章将围绕“区块链技术应用学什么”这一主题,深入挖掘区块链的学习内容、应用领域以及学习路径等方面。我们将从多个方面探讨这一技术,形成一个全面的知识框架,助力有意学习区块链的读者。 ### 区块链技术应用概述

              区块链可以被看作是一种分布式账本技术,通过密码学保证交易的安全性和可靠性。与传统的集中式存储模式不同,区块链通过去中心化的方式,将数据分散存储在多个节点上,确保信息的可追溯性和透明性。

              在应用上,区块链技术不仅限于加密货币,它的潜力还扩展到金融、物联网、医疗、投票、版权保护等多个领域。学习区块链技术的应用,首先需要理解其基本原理和使用场景,接下来将详细介绍具体学习内容和应用实例。

              ### 区块链的基础知识 #### 区块链的工作原理

              区块链的存储结构由区块(Block)和链(Chain)构成。每个区块包含了一组交易记录和相关的元数据,例如时间戳和前一个区块的哈希值。通过哈希算法,每个区块的内容都与前一个区块紧密相连,形成一条不可篡改的链条。

              #### 区块链的核心技术

              区块链的核心技术包括:哈希算法、共识机制和智能合约。哈希算法用于确保数据安全,任何对数据的修改都会导致哈希值的改变;共识机制则保证了分布式网络中节点之间的数据一致性,常见的机制有Proof of Work(工作量证明)和Proof of Stake(权益证明)等;而智能合约则是一种自动执行合约的程序,能够在满足特定条件时自动进行代币的转账等操作。

              ### 学习区块链应用的必要性 #### 职业前景

              随着区块链技术的逐渐成熟,越来越多的企业开始认识到其重要性,并积极布局这一领域。根据最新的行业报告,区块链开发者的需求将持续增长,成为未来几年最具潜力的职业之一。掌握区块链技术,将为职业发展提供更多机会。

              #### 行业应用

              除了金融行业外,区块链技术在医疗、能源、物流等行业的应用也在快速增长。例如,区块链可以帮助医药公司追踪药品从生产到销售的每一个环节,保证其安全性;在供应链管理中,区块链可以提高透明度,减少欺诈行为。因此,了解这些应用能够为学习者提供实践机会。

              ### 如何学习区块链技术 #### 学习路径

              基础课程

              要学习区块链,首先需要了解其基本知识和原理。有许多在线课程和书籍可以帮助初学者奠定基础,比如Coursera、edX等平台上的相关课程。

              实践项目

              区块链技术应用的全面解析:从基础知识到实践技能

              实践是学习区块链最有效的方法之一。建议找一些开源项目参与贡献,实际编写代码,或者自己动手建立简单的区块链应用,加深对理论的理解。

              社区与资源

              加入区块链相关的社区,参与论坛讨论,跟踪行业动态,可以获得最新的信息和资源。比如,GitHub上有不少开源的区块链项目,可以得到很多有价值的实践经验。

              ### 可能相关的问题 #### 1. 区块链技术的实际应用案例有哪些?

              金融服务

              区块链技术应用的全面解析:从基础知识到实践技能

              在金融行业,区块链技术被广泛用于跨境支付、资产交易和清算等领域。以Ripple为例,其技术帮助银行实现了跨境支付的实时确认,大大提高了效率和安全性。

              供应链管理

              在供应链领域,IBM和沃尔玛合作开发的Food Trust项目利用区块链技术来追踪食品来源,保证其安全性,并提高消费透明度。

              医疗数据管理

              医疗行业也在探索区块链技术的应用,比如通过区块链存储患者的医疗记录,确保数据的隐私和安全,同时方便不同医疗机构之间的信息共享。

              #### 2. 学习区块链的最佳途径是什么?

              自学与课程

              对于初学者来说,自学基础知识和参加在线课程是最佳途径。例如,Udemy和Coursera上都有区块链相关的课程,涵盖从基础到进阶的内容。同时,参与实战项目也是实现知识转化的重要途径。

              开源项目

              通过参与GitHub上的开源项目,可以在实际中学习如何构建区块链应用,这不仅能提高编程技能,还可以丰富个人的项目经验。

              行业网络

              参加相关技术会议和研讨会,结识业内专家,了解最新的技术动态,可以帮助学习者在这个快速变化的领域中保持竞争力。

              #### 3. 区块链与其他技术(如人工智能和IoT)的结合前景怎样?

              智能合约与人工智能

              智能合约可以与人工智能结合,通过决策算法自动执行合约,提高效率。比如在保险领域,AI可以评估风险,决定是否触发赔付的智能合约。

              物联网与区块链

              区块链技术可以帮助物联网设备实现去中心化管理,通过区块链记录设备间的交互,增强安全性,降低数据篡改的风险。例如,ChainLink正在将区块链引入物联网,实现设备间的数据传输并进行智能合约执行。

              未来的结合趋势

              未来,这些技术的结合将生成新的应用场景,提高效率并降低成本,从而推动各行各业的变革。

              #### 4. 学习区块链会面临哪些挑战?

              技术复杂性

              区块链的理论和技术架构较为复杂,初学者需要理解密码学、算法及网络等多个领域的知识,可能会在学习过程中产生一定的困难。

              快速变化的行业环境

              区块链是一个发展迅速的领域,随时会出现新的技术和标准,学习者需要保持与时俱进,积极学习最新的动态,才能跟上行业的步伐。

              资源选择的多样性

              市面上关于区块链的学习资源繁多,初学者可能难以判断哪些资源是有效的,需注意甄别,提高学习效率。

              #### 5. 区块链技术的未来发展趋势如何?

              规范化和标准化

              未来,区块链技术的发展将趋向于规范化和标准化,以提高不同区块链平台之间的互操作性。同时,法律法规的完善将为区块链的广泛应用铺平道路。

              跨行业应用的扩展

              区块链将持续扩展到金融以外的多个行业,如教育、广告、版权等,取代传统的信任机制,赋能企业创新。

              区块链的可持续性与环保

              随着环保意识的提升,区块链技术的可持续性将成为未来的研发趋势,例如开发更多环保的共识机制,以减少能源消耗。

              ### 结论 区块链技术是一项极具潜力的创新技术,其学习和应用将为个人职业发展和行业进步带来新机遇。通过本文的介绍,相信你对“区块链技术应用学什么”这个问题有了更为全面的理解。希望你能够积极探索这一领域,开启你的学习之旅。
                
                        <noscript id="ctgy"></noscript><pre dropzone="zmqb"></pre><small dir="_qy6"></small><abbr draggable="wzsy"></abbr><em lang="kd9a"></em><ins lang="5ua3"></ins><time dir="537m"></time><time dropzone="ibw6"></time><small date-time="y3ur"></small><center draggable="4j80"></center><acronym dropzone="ba26"></acronym><time draggable="et_n"></time><dl date-time="yiqg"></dl><del lang="ou1h"></del><font id="jl94"></font><style date-time="1_w7"></style><style draggable="_rjm"></style><legend date-time="9b70"></legend><em dropzone="a3xc"></em><ol dropzone="7qaf"></ol><ol id="_zf8"></ol><font id="4_tl"></font><address id="j82e"></address><ul lang="xp0u"></ul><noscript id="d4a4"></noscript><sub dir="2g3r"></sub><bdo id="_je4"></bdo><em dir="1fcu"></em><strong dir="b1g6"></strong><address date-time="8a3z"></address><em dropzone="9a4a"></em><address dir="6i6k"></address><sub lang="8lzp"></sub><em draggable="mya4"></em><strong id="1jug"></strong><small dropzone="j3ef"></small><noframes lang="mvtz">
                  author

                  Appnox App

                  content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                  related post

                                  
                                          
                                          <strong id="t23d"></strong><em dropzone="n1f1"></em><big date-time="237i"></big><dfn id="93js"></dfn><strong id="elgw"></strong><abbr id="1zmj"></abbr><ins dir="hxs3"></ins><strong lang="9t84"></strong><abbr date-time="y2_s"></abbr><del draggable="59ov"></del><sub draggable="x8ey"></sub><bdo dropzone="n66b"></bdo><ul dropzone="xhbg"></ul><ul dropzone="ii2m"></ul><kbd lang="2s_f"></kbd><code date-time="x532"></code><dl dropzone="rxn_"></dl><dl id="keek"></dl><big lang="mvia"></big><u lang="6ejm"></u><big dir="y5rp"></big><sub id="lhe3"></sub><ul dropzone="zbpq"></ul><noframes draggable="xad1">

                                    leave a reply